Sony claimed the top-selling platform of the month (with over a million units), in other words, they sold the most consoles to consumers during November, even topping the mighty Nintendo 3DS (which pushed more than 770K).
Microsoft countered with a “fastest-selling console” metric, which means that the Xbox One sold more per day during the same time-frame even though they sold less overall (apparently just shy of 1 million units). Taking into account that the Xbox One launched a week after the PS4, and like the PS4, nearly every pre-order was sold, you can see how they came up with that result.
Sony also claimed the “biggest console launch ever” milestone also and even put together a little video to celebrate.[youtube_sc url=”8dF_RJz2p9k” width=”600″]
What do these numbers really tell us? That new consoles are still hot business… with the exception of the Wii U unfortunately.
